As a young researcher in the 1980s, I used then-new imaging technologies to look at the brains of people with drug dependencies and, for comparison, people without drug problems. As we began to track and document these unique images of the brain, my colleagues and I realized that these images offered the very first evidence in people that there were modifications in the brains of addicted people that could discuss the compulsive nature of their drug taking.

Particular opioid medications such as methadone and more buprenorphine are extensively utilized to treat dependency and reliance on other opioids such as heroin, morphine or oxycodone. Methadone and buprenorphine are upkeep therapies meant to lower yearnings for opiates, thereby minimizing illegal drug use, and the dangers associated with it, such as disease, arrest, imprisonment, and death, in line with the viewpoint of damage reduction.

Everything about Which Treats Nicotine Addiction

All available research studies gathered in the 2005 Australian National Examination of Pharmacotherapies for Opioid Dependence suggest that upkeep treatment is preferable, with very high rates (79100%) of regression within 3 months of cleansing from levo-- acetylmethadol (LAAM), buprenorphine, and methadone. According to the National Institute on Drug Abuse (NIDA), clients stabilized on adequate, sustained dosages of methadone or buprenorphine can keep their jobs, prevent crime and violence, and minimize their exposure to HIV and Hepatitis C by stopping or reducing injection substance abuse and drug-related high threat sexual behavior.

It is generally recommended in outpatient medical conditions. Naltrexone blocks the blissful impacts of alcohol and opiates. Naltrexone cuts relapse danger in the very first three months by about 36%. However, it is far less reliable in helping clients preserve abstaining or maintaining them in the drug-treatment system (retention rates typical 12% at 90 days for naltrexone, average 57% at 90 days for buprenorphine, typical 61% at 90 days for methadone).

The phenomenon of drug addiction has taken place to some degree throughout recorded history (see "Opium").

Enhanced ways of active biological representative manufacture and the introduction of artificial substances, such as fentanyl and methamphetamine, are also factors adding to drug addiction. For the whole of US history, drugs have been used by some members of the population. In the country's early years, many substance abuse by the settlers was of alcohol or tobacco.

Morphine was isolated in the early 19th century, and became prescribed typically by doctors, both as a pain reliever and as an intended cure for opium dependency. At the time, the dominating medical viewpoint was that the dependency process occurred in the stomach, and therefore it was hypothesized that patients would not become addicted to morphine if it http://caribfind.tel/listing/transformations-treatment-center.html was injected into them by means of a hypodermic needle, and it was more assumed that this may potentially have the ability to treat opium dependency.

In particular, addiction to opium ended up being prevalent amongst soldiers battling in the Civil War, who very often required painkillers and thus were very often recommended morphine. Women were also very often recommended opiates, and opiates were marketed as being able to eliminate "female problems". Many soldiers in the Vietnam War were introduced to heroin and developed a reliance on the compound which made it through even when they returned to the US.

In 1974 sociologist Lee Robins conducted a substantial research study of U.S. servicemen addicted to heroin returning from Vietnam. While in Vietnam, 20 percent of servicemen became addicted to heroin, and among the things Robins wished to examine was the number of of them continued to utilize it upon their return to the U.S.

What she found was that the remission rate was surprisingly high: only around 7 percent utilized heroin after returning to the U.S., and only about 1-2 percent had a relapse, even quickly, into dependency. The vast bulk of addicted soldiers stopped using by themselves. Also in the 1970s, psychologists at Simon Fraser University in Canada conducted the famous "Rat Park" experiment in which caged isolated rats administered to themselves ever increasingand typically deadlydoses of morphine when no alternatives were available.
